What would be the result of a chemical interfering with the ability of RNA polymerase to bind to a DNA molecule?
A: DNA would mutate
B: Transcription would not take place, and the protein would not be produced
C: Transcription would proceed, and a protein would be produced
D: The RNA polymerase would be consumed

Respuesta :

DNA is a molecule that carries genetic material of an organism while RNA is a molecule involved in the formation of proteins which are crucial in cellular activities. RNA polymerase is an enzyme that carries out transcription of DNA to form a mRNA which then undergoes translation to form proteins. Therefore;chemical interfering of the ability of RNA polymerase to bind DNA molecule means that transcription would not take place and consequently translation would not take place.
